Your journey

Up into the mountains

The Turracher Höhe is a picturesque high plateau in the Austrian Alps, located on the border between Styria and Carinthia. There are several ways to get there by car, depending on which direction you are coming from.

On site

Parking in winter

As our house has no direct access in winter, we ask our guests to park on the opposite side of the lake, where we will pick you and your luggage up with our snowmobile. Please let us know as soon as you arrive and let us know where you park.

As there have been various parking bans on the Styrian side of the Turracher Höhe since 2024, we have marked the recommended car parks on the map.

On site

Parking in summer

In summer you can drive along the natural road along the lake directly in front of our house, unload there and then park next to the house.

The map shows you the exact route. Please drive slowly, as the path is also used by pedestrians and cyclists.

Snow & ice
Winter conditions

In winter, the roads to Turracher Höhe can be heavily snow-covered. Therefore, make sure you drive with winter tyres or snow chains.

Asfinag
Tolls

In Austria, a vignette is mandatory for all motorways. In addition, some motorway sections are subject to tolls.

You can order both online in advance for your holiday in the Asfinag webshop.
